Changing and Renewing Your Registered Agent
Modifying your appointed agent is a simple process, but it is essential to follow the statutory requirements of your jurisdiction. Most jurisdictions ask you to submit a agent change change form and submit it to the appropriate state agency. This form typically entails information about the existing registered agent, the replacement agent, and the company involved. It may also require obtaining permission from the new agent to serve on behalf of your company. FAQs on Services of Registered Agents
One of the most common inquiries about the services of registered agents is what precisely a registered agent does. A registered agent acts as the designated point of contact for a business, handling crucial legal documents and government correspondence. This includes receiving service of process, which denotes legal notifications such as lawsuits. The registered agent also makes sure that the business stays compliant with state regulations by sending necessary documents and alerts regarding annual filings or other statutory requirements.
